Key Applications
Pigment Production
As a primary black iron oxide for paints and inks, Triiron tetraoxide provides deep, stable coloration, crucial for industrial coatings, watercolors, and oil paints.
Pharmaceutical & Medical
Our Triiron tetraoxide pharmaceutical grade is vital for analytical reagents and in the synthesis of advanced compounds like ferumoxytol for anemia treatment and specialized Fe3O4 MRI contrast agent production.
Industrial Catalysis
It serves as a highly effective Triiron tetraoxide industrial catalyst in key chemical processes, including the Haber process and water-gas shift reactions, enhancing efficiency and yields.
Electronics & Specialty Materials
Triiron tetraoxide finds unique roles in the electronics industry, as well as in specialty materials like steel bluing and as a component in thermite, showcasing its broad technical utility.
